Услуга имена домена или ДНС једна је одкамен темељац савремених ИП мрежа, укључујући Интернет, најпознатија мрежа свих. Једина сврха ДНС-а је пронаћи ИП адресу рачунара када је све само име рачунара. Колико год то једноставно изгледало, у ствари је прилично сложено. На Интернет скали, сваки корисник мора бити у могућности да нађе ИП адресу било ког ресурса, ма где се налазио. На локалној разини, ДНС мора ријешити било које име хоста на својој локалној ИП адреси и прослиједити интернетске захтјеве јавним ДНС серверима. За помоћ мрежним администраторима у ефикасном управљању ДНС-ом, на располагању је неколико различитих алата. Неки ће вам помоћи у подешавању ДНС-а, док ће други помоћи у решавању проблема или надгледању вашег ДНС окружења. Данас ћемо прегледати неке од најбољих ДНС алата који су данас доступни.
Ми ћемо започети нашу расправу покушајемобјасните шта је ДНС и како функционише. Потрудићемо се да то буде што више нетехнички. Затим ћемо разговарати о управљању ДНС-ом. Погледаћемо различите аспекте управљања ДНС-ом. А пошто се овај чланак односи на алате, ми ћемо онда представити различите врсте ДНС алата који су доступни мрежним администраторима. То ће нас, наравно, довести до нашег основног предмета: најбољих расположивих ДНС алата. Прегледаћемо неке од најкориснијих алата које бисмо могли смислити.
ДНС - шта је то и како функционише
У првим данима Интернета свега неколиконеколико рачунара је било међусобно повезано како би се избегло да им се обраћа помоћу гломазних ИП адреса, сваки рачунар има име домаћина и сваки међусобно повезани рачунар је имао текстуалну датотеку - прикладно названу „домаћини“ - која је садржавала ИП адресу за преписку имена хоста сваког другог рачунара на мрежи.
Све док је било ограниченог бројамеђусобно повезани рачунари, то је функционисало добро, али убрзо је постало очигледно да треба осмислити неки бољи начин дистрибуције информација. ДНС је тако креиран управо за ту сврху. Укратко, ДНС је дистрибуирана верзија датотеке „хостс“ која може разрешити ИП адресу било којег имена хоста. Лепота ДНС-а је што је дистрибуирани систем у којем је сваки локални администратор одговоран само за чување података о домаћинима којима управља на ДНС серверима.
Свака организација има локални ДНСсервер. Одговорна је за решавање ИП адреса за локалне ресурсе. Тај сервер ће послати било који захтев који не може да реши на свој сервер за прослеђивање, јавни ДНС сервер на Интернету. Уштедећу вам детаље о томе како се тачно ради, али сваки сервер јавних имена може решити било које јавно име домаћина на јавној ИП адреси. Поред тога, ваш локални ДНС сервер може то и учинити јер ће прослеђивати захтеве јавном серверу.
Један од недостатака ове архитектуре је тајрешавање ИП адресе може трајати неко време јер би можда требало да многи сервери проследе захтев другом. Овај ефекат ублажава локално кеширање. Кад год ДНС сервер затражи неке информације у име или неки други сервер, он ће и даље кеширати те податке. Следећи пут када је буде затражено, неће је морати дохватити са другог сервера. Кеширање није вечно, али пре или касније ће истећи и захтевати од сервера да затраже друге сервере.
Управљање ДНС-ом
Управљање локалним ДНС-ом је важан задатак. Сваки пут када се на уређај дода нови уређај - било да је рачунар, штампач или било који део мрежне опреме - његово име домаћина и одговарајућа ИП адреса морају се додати локалном ДНС серверу. У зависности од тога како управљате ИП адресама и којим алатом користите, то би могао бити потпуно ручни процес, потпуно аутоматизован или било шта између тога.
Други важан аспект управљања ДНС-ом јеосигуравајући да је резолуција имена ваших јавно доступних ресурса - на пример ваше веб локације - исправно конфигурисана и доступна на јавним ДНС серверима да би их било који корисник могао достићи.
Надгледање је још један важан део ДНС-аадминистрација. Када је ДНС искључен, није могуће име главног рачунара на ИП адресу и сви међусобно повезани ресурси постају недоступни. Ово је дефинитивно нешто што би желели да избегну.
Различите врсте ДНС алата
Постоји неколико различитих врста ДНС алатадоступан. Прва врста су ДНС алати за ревизију. Ове врсте алата извршават ће напријед и обрнуто ДНС захтјеве како би потврдили да се оба подударају. Ово је врло корисно јер неусклађени напријед и обрнути уноси могу узроковати све врсте проблема.
Друга врста алата може се користити за анализуструктуру ваше ДНС архитектуре. Може открити односе између ДНС сервера и помоћи вам да имате више детерминиран приступ ДНС резолуцији. Као што смо рекли раније, просљеђивање ДНС захтјева може завршити вријеме па ћете бити бољи са ефикасном архитектуром коју ће вам ова врста алата помоћи да потврдите. У ту сврху се може користити и ДНС софтвер за вредновање. Баш као што се може користити за поређење перформанси једног јавног ДНС сервера са другим, што би вам могло помоћи да одредите најбољи јавни ДНС сервер на који ће захтеве проследити.
Следе алати наредбеног ретка који се обично користе за тестирање резолуције имена ручним постављањем упита сервера. Нслоокуп и Диг су две такве команде које ћемо размотрити касније.
Последња врста алата је мрежни алат који можекористи се за покретање различитих ДНС оријентисаних тестова са више локација широм света. Ови алати вам могу пружити прилично добру представу о томе како се ваши домаћини решавају од удаљених клијената.
Најбољи ДНС алати
Са толико врста алата на располагању, проналажењенајбољи нису били лак задатак. Покушали смо да пронађемо барем једну од сваке врсте алата како бисмо вам представили шта је на располагању. Због тога укључујемо софтверске пакете који се могу инсталирати на локалном нивоу, алате наредбеног ретка који су већ уграђени у већину оперативних система и мрежне алате.
1. Скуп алата СоларВиндс Енгинеер-а (Бесплатна реклама)

Наша прва два алата су део овог Скуп алата СоларВиндс Енгинеер-а. Можда већ знате СоларВиндс. Можда чак користите неке од његових производа. Компанија је себи стекла солидну репутацију за прављење неких од најбољих алата за мрежно управљање. Његов водећи производ, Нетворк Перформанце Монитор, многи су препознати као један од најбољих алата за праћење мреже. СоларВиндс је такође познат по многим бесплатним алатима. Они су мањи алати, сваки се бави специфичним потребама мрежних администратора. Два примера ових бесплатних алата су Адванцед Субнет Цалцулатор и Киви Сислог Сервер.
Повратак на сет алата СоларВиндс Енгинеер, овоје сноп од преко 60 различитих алата. Неки од укључених алата су бесплатни алати СоларВиндс, док су други алати који се искључиво налазе у склопу овог пакета. Што се тиче ДНС алата, два су укључена у Инжењеров сет алата, СоларВиндс ДНС ревизија и СоларВиндс ДНС анализатор структуре. Што се тиче осталих алата које пакет садржи, ми ћемо им се вратити убрзо.
- БЕСПЛАТНА РЕКЛАМА: СоларВиндс Енгинеер сет алата
- Званична веза за преузимање: https://www.solarwinds.com/engineers-toolset
1.1 СоларВиндс ДНС ревизија (БЕСПЛАТНО пробно суђење са Инжењеровим сетом алата)
Тхе Алат за ревизију СоларВиндс ДНС је углавном корисно администраторима који управљају иподесите њихов ДНС ручно. Чини се прилично једноставно, али су његове користи невероватне. Овај алат ће скенирати низ ИП адреса и издати обрнуте ДНС упите за сваку адресу. Обрнути ДНС је процес испитивања ДНС сервера како би добио име хоста које одговара ИП адреси уместо обрнуто. Исправно конфигурисан ДНС сервер треба да има обрнути ДНС запис за сваки напредни запис који садржи.

Дакле, када алат заврши са решавањем сваког ИП-аадресе у име хоста, т ће покушати да разријеши свако име домаћина на његову ИП адресу и извјештава о свим записима у којима је пронађена несклад. Резултат ревизије је приказан у табеларном облику са једном линијом за сваку скенирану ИП адресу.
- Званична веза за преузимање: https://www.solarwinds.com/engineers-toolset/dns-audit/
1.2 СоларВиндс ДНС анализатор структуре (БЕСПЛАТНО пробно суђење са Инжењеровим сетом алата)
Следећи алат из скупа алата СоларВиндс инжењера, Алат за анализу структуре СоларВиндс ДНС је веома различита у ономе што ради и како то радиоперише. Овај алат ће открити и креирати визуелне дијаграме хијерархијске ДНС структуре записа ДНС ресурса ваше организације, укључујући роот сервере, сервере имена, глобалне сервере домена највишег нивоа, показиваче цНаме и ауторитативне сервере адреса. Алат такође омогућава лако разликовање односа између више послужитеља имена и циљних ИП адреса помоћу ДНС структуре дијаграма. Поред тога, графички се приказују преусмеравања са једног ДНС сервера на други.
Тхе Алат за анализу структуре СоларВиндс ДНС можда није за све, али за оне који је имајупотреба за овом врстом алата не може се заиста победити. А пошто је део бесплатне пробне верзије програма Енгинеер'с Тоолсет, можемо само да вам предлажемо да покушате и сами се уверите ако имате потребу за тим.
- Званична веза за преузимање: https://www.solarwinds.com/engineers-toolset/dns-structure-analyzer
Остали алати укључени у сет алата за инжењере
Пакет алата СоларВиндс Енгинеер укључује многосјајни алати за решавање проблема Пронаћи ћете алате као што су Пинг Свееп, ДНС анализатор и ТрацеРоуте који се могу користити за обављање дијагностике мреже и за брзо решавање сложених мрежних проблема. А за администраторе који имају свест о безбедности, неки од алата могу се користити да симулирају нападе на вашу мрежу и помогну у препознавању рањивости.
Пакет алата СоларВиндс Енгинеер такође има некеодличан алат за праћење и упозоравање. Неки ће надгледати ваше уређаје и подизати упозорења када открију проблеме са доступношћу или здравственим проблемима. То вам често може дати довољно времена за реакцију и прије него што корисници примијете да постоји проблем. А да ствар буде још боља, можете користити неке од укључених алата за управљање конфигурацијом и консолидацију дневника.
Ево неких алата који ћете наћи у алату СоларВиндс Енгинеер-а осим ДНС ревизије и Алат-а за анализу структуре ДНС-а.
- Порт Сцаннер
- Свитцх Порт Маппер
- СНМП свееп
- ИП Нетворк Бровсер
- Откривање МАЦ адресе
- Пинг Свееп
- Монитор тиме респонсе
- ЦПУ Монитор
- Монитор са интерфејсом
- ТрацеРоуте
- Дешифрирање лозинке рутера
- СНМП Бруте Форце Аттацк
- СНМП рјечник напада
- Конфигуришите Упоређивање, Довнлоадер, Уплоадер и Едитор
- СНМП уређивач замки и СНМП трап пријемник
- Субнет Цалцулатор
- ДХЦП опсег монитора
- ДНС анализатор структуре
- ДНС ревизија
- Управљање ИП адресама
- ВАН Киллер
У СоларВиндс је укључено много алатаИнжењерски сет алата Превише њих да их све спомињем. Са бесплатним пробним периодом од 14 дана, можда је ваш најбољи кладионица преузети пакет и уверите се у све оно што скуп алата може учинити за вас.
- БЕСПЛАТНА РЕКЛАМА: Инжењерски сет алата од стране СоларВиндс
- Званична веза за преузимање: https://www.solarwinds.com/engineers-toolset
2. ГРЦ-ова ДНС мера
Назив овог алата пуно говори о томе шта је. Ако се питате да ли ваш избор ДНС сервера омета ваше интернетско искуство, ГРЦ-ова ДНС мера пружиће јединствен, свеобухватан, тачан и бесплатан Виндовс - и Линук када се користи Вине - услужни програм за одређивање тачних перформанси локалних и удаљених ДНС сервера.

Иако је ГРЦ-ов ДНС Бенцхмарк у пакетуфункције за задовољавање потреба чак и најзахтевнијих и искусних мрежних администратора - а нуди и функције дизајниране да омогуће озбиљно испитивање перформанси ДНС-а, алат је такође изузетно једноставан за употребу, чак и за повремене и почетнике. Једна од најбољих карактеристика овог алата је његова цена. Иако производ нема опен-соурце извор, бесплатан је и свако га може преузети.
3. Нслоокуп
Следеће на нашој листи је прилично користан алат за решавање проблема који је обухваћен већином оперативних система - укључујући све модерне верзије Виндовс-а нслоокуп. Често се занемарује као решавање проблемаалатка, али доноси стварну вредност. Нслоокуп је један од најосновнијих алата који можете да користите за потврду исправне конфигурације ДНС сервера. Назив је скраћен за „проналазак имена сервера“.
Види нслоокуп на послу је најбољи начин да схватите шта тоима и како од тога можете имати користи, па ћемо почети са малом демонстрацијом. Употреба команде је прилично једноставна, само је упишете након чега слиједи оно што тражите. За наш пример, користићемо ввв.гоогле.цом.
Команда би изгледала овако:
C:>nslookup www.google.com
А ево како би изгледао одговор са нслоокуп-а:
Server: my.local.dns.server Address: 10.10.10.10 Non-authoritative answer: Name: www.google.com Addresses: 2607:f8b0:4002:80f::2004 172.217.4.4
Прва два ретка одговора вам говоре штасервер који користи за добијање информација и ИП адресу тог сервера. Подразумевано ће користити први ДНС сервер који је конфигурисан на рачунару на којем користите наредбу. У другом вам нслоокуп говори да даје неауторитативан одговор. То не треба да се брине. То само значи да је сервер који даје одговор добио информације од другог сервера. У ствари, било би прилично изненађујуће добити ауторитативан одговор од ДНС сервера вашег локалног рачунара. То обично видите када постављате питање о другој локалној машини. Следе, наравно, информације о вашем стварном упиту. Нслоокуп прво наводи име које сте упитали, а затим стварни одговор или, у конкретном случају, одговоре. У нашем примеру, упит је вратио и ИПВ6 и ИПВ4 адресу.
Нслоокуп такође има интерактивни режим који активиратекуцањем команде по себи. Једном када се алат покрене - приметићете да се наредбена промена мења у „>“ - спремни сте да директно одговорите на команде.
Постоји много различитих начина на које можете питатиДНС сервери са нслоокупом. Информације о подешавањима поштанског сервера можете дохваћати само тако што у интерактивни режим упишете „сет типе = мк“. Такође се можете повезати са одређеним ДНС сервером. На пример, да бисте се повезали са Гоогле-овим ДНС сервером, откуцали бисте „сервер 8.8.8.8“.
Нслоокуп има много више могућности од тога и то им помажебити информисан о услузи имена домена да бисте је максимално искористили. Иако је ово датирани алат и многи би волели да га замени нечим модернијим - попут копања, нашег следећег алата - и даље је један од најчешће коришћених ДНС алата.
4. Копати
Копати је још један алат командне линије који је све више добијао на популарности. Његова намена је скоро идентична нслоокуп-овој, али његова синтакса је мало другачија. Такође, одговоре од копати су мало сложенији од оних из нслоокупља. То је један од разлога зашто копати није успео да надјача свог старијег рођака. Други разлог је тај што је, док је нслоокуп готово на сваком систему, копати присутан је само на неким Линук дистрибуцијама. Може се инсталирати на било који Линук или Виндовс рачунар, али многим администраторима зашто се гњавити када нслоокуп обави посао?
Овако изгледа типични упит за копање:
$ dig -t mx www.google.com ; <<>> DiG 9.10.3-P4-Ubuntu <<>> -t mx www.google.com ;; global options: +cmd ;; Got answer: ;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 40683 ;; flags: qr rd ra; QUERY: 1, ANSWER: 0, AUTHORITY: 1, ADDITIONAL: 1 ;; OPT PSEUDOSECTION: ; EDNS: version: 0, flags:; udp: 4096 ;; QUESTION SECTION: ;www.google.com. IN MX ;; AUTHORITY SECTION: google.com. 60 IN SOA ns1.google.com. dns-admin.google.com. 164707171 900 900 1800 60 ;; Query time: 61 msec ;; SERVER: 127.0.1.1#53(127.0.1.1) ;; WHEN: Wed Aug 09 14:34:03 EDT 2017 ;; MSG SIZE rcvd: 113
Као што видите, то је много сложеније од типичног одговора нслоокупа.
5. Онлине ДНС алати - ДНСстуфф
Последњи скуп ДНС алата о којима желимо да разговарамосу онлајн ДНС алати. Ти алати могу бити врло корисни јер вам дају другачију перспективу, ону удаљеног уређаја негде на Интернету. Постоји безброј веб локација које нуде ДНС алате. Они се разликују у тачним алаткама које нуде, али сви ће вам барем омогућити да добијете јавну ИП адресу од потпуно квалификованог имена домена.

На пример, ДНСстуфф је један такав вебсајт који нуди десетакразличите алате за тестирање различитих аспеката ДНС-а, укључујући разрађен и једноставан за употребу еквивалент нслоокуп-а или копања. Главни недостатак ових врста алата је тај што обично не можете одабрати одређени ДНС сервер. Оно што добијате је перспектива са удаљене Интернет локације.
Коментари